An American owned company that is sadly more of an asset group now. Despite a star studded lineup of owners and management from across the billiard industry the pool tables they are producing, or importing to be correct, are subpar in terms of quality. I will credit them, if you are a shopper whose main focus is looks for the money, C.L Bailey’s products are at the top of the imported list just a step below Legacy. Still not what I will call a quality piece but as a piece of furniture to look at not bad. In terms of value new, you can do much better with a used table from a quality manufacturer. And there are new tables of far higher quality available in similar price points. Used, these tables range from no value for a lower end Addison to no more than $300 for a pristine “wood” table. Older Baileys from their pre import days may be worth much more but are very hard to find and take a real professional to identify.
